My teams and direct reports have gifted me several "Adamism" t-shirts and coffee mugs over the years emblazoned with sayings I drive into their heads and then into the ground. For example: - Alignment comes before Autonomy - Every line of code is technical debt - Be kind to Future You - There's no "Best", only "Least Worst" - Research isn't proof - You have to be willing to be.bad at something if you want to be good at it and of course... - Make your problem smaller [Eat the Elephant] My professional journey spans hands on full stack and system administration, technical and organizational consulting, leadership and strategic execution in software engineering, and entrepreneurial ventures.
